Understanding imToken Wallet and Network Congestion

What is imToken Wallet?

imToken is a popular multichain cryptocurrency wallet that allows users to manage a variety of digital assets, including Ethereum and Bitcoin. The wallet supports decentralized applications (dApps) and provides features such as token swaps, staking, and many more. As more users adopt the platform, understanding how fees interact with network conditions has become crucial.

What is Network Congestion?

Network congestion occurs when the volume of transactions exceeds the network's capacity to process them. During these periods, the time it takes for a transaction to be confirmed can increase, leading to higher transaction fees. Users may be required to offer higher fees to incentivize miners to prioritize their transactions, resulting in financial implications for those using the imToken wallet.

Affiliation Between Network Congestion and Fees

  • Dynamic Fee Structures
  • imToken, like many other cryptocurrency wallets, employs a dynamic fee structure. This means that the fees associated with transactions can vary significantly based on network conditions. During times of low congestion, fees may be lower, while periods of high congestion lead to increased fees as users compete to have their transactions processed more quickly.

    RealWorld Example:

    In a scenario where Ethereum’s network experiences a surge in activity due to a popular token's launch or an NFT drop, the average gas fees can spike dramatically. When this occurs, users utilizing imToken may notice that the fees they are charged for executing transactions have increased, even if their transaction size has not changed.

  • Transaction Priority
  • Due to network congestion, the priority given to transactions can significantly affect the fees paid by users. When the network is congested, miners prioritize transactions based on the fees attached. Users willing to pay higher fees will have their transactions processed more quickly compared to those who attach minimal fees.

    Example:

    If you set a transaction fee of 20 gwei (a unit of Ethereum gas) during a congested period, your transaction might take longer than if you set a fee of 50 gwei, as the latter would give miners an incentive to include it in the next block of processed transactions.

  • ImToken Fee Estimates
  • imToken offers users the ability to view estimated fees prior to confirming a transaction. These fee estimates are based on current network conditions and can guide users in determining the optimal time and fee for their transactions.

    Practical Tip:

    Monitor the estimated fees provided within the imToken wallet interface and choose to execute transactions when estimates are lower, thereby saving on overall transaction costs.

  • Transaction Timing
  • The timing of transactions can play a crucial role in managing fees. Peak hours for network activity usually correspond with higher fees. Therefore, users can save on fees by conducting transactions during offpeak times.

    Strategy:

    For instance, research shows that weekends or late at night (UTC) often experience reduced transaction activities for Ethereum and various tokens. Planning transactions during these times can reduce the overall fees incurred.

  • Utilizing Layer 2 Solutions
  • Layer 2 solutions, such as Polygon or Optimism, aim to alleviate congestion on the primary blockchain by allowing transactions to occur offchain. By using imToken, users can interact with such solutions, which typically offer lower transaction fees.

    Application:

    If a user wants to swap tokens or make small transactions, they could do so on a Layer 2 network like Polygon, significantly reducing the fees compared to conducting the same activity on the Ethereum mainnet.

    Fee Management Techniques

  • Leveraging Fee Tracking Tools
  • Several websites offer realtime insights into current gas fees for the Ethereum network. Tools like GasNow or ETH Gas Station provide users with the necessary information to time their transactions better.

  • Setting Custom Fees
  • imToken allows users to set custom transaction fees. By opting for a medium or low fee rather than the default high fee, users can avoid overpaying while still securing a timely transaction.

  • Batch Transactions
  • For users executing multiple transactions, batching them can help reduce fees. imToken may provide options for batch transactions, lowering the overall fees as they get processed together.

  • Prioritize Transactions
  • If a user does not require an immediate confirmation of a transaction, they can opt for lower fees that may result in delayed processing. Services like imToken allow users to prioritize their transactions based on their needs.

  • Engaging in Periodic Fee Review
  • By regularly reviewing and adjusting their transaction habits based on fee fluctuations and network conditions, users can ensure they are making informed decisions and minimizing costs.

    Frequently Asked Questions

    What affects the fee structure in the imToken wallet?

    The fee structure in the imToken wallet is affected by network congestion, the complexity of the transaction, and the current demand for block space.

    How can I find out the current gas fees before making a transaction?

    You can access the fee estimation feature within the imToken wallet, which provides realtime data based on current network conditions.

    Are there any strategies to reduce my transaction fees with imToken?

    Yes, strategies include conducting transactions during offpeak hours, using Layer 2 solutions, batching transactions, and customizing fees.

    Is there a way to automate fee management in imToken?

    Currently, imToken does not offer automatic fee management, but you can use external tracking tools to inform your transaction timing better.

    What happens if I set my transaction fee too low?

    If you set your transaction fee too low, your transaction may take longer to process, or it may not get processed at all, as miners may prioritize higherfee transactions.

    Can network congestion be predicted?

    While exact predictions are difficult, monitoring activity trends and major events in the cryptocurrency space can provide insights into potential congestion periods.
